Sr. Director, Brand Lead, Neuroscience

Position Summary

The Senior Director, Brand Lead, Neuroscience is responsible for leading the commercial strategy, brand positioning, launch readiness planning, and execution within a therapeutic category (schizophrenia and other psychiatric disorders), ensuring a successful launch and sustained market growth. This role will drive the development of HCP and consumer marketing strategies, optimizing engagement and adoption through omnichannel execution, market development, and field force enablement.

In addition, this role will help steer the global Lifecycle Management plan across multiple potential psychiatric disorders. Responsible for development the commercial go-to market model and overall cross-functional launch plan.

The Senior Director will lead a cross-functional team, working closely with market access, sales, medical affairs, regulatory, and commercial excellence to align on strategic priorities and ensure a competitive market presence. The candidate will have financial responsibility for the product P&L. This role requires a highly strategic and execution-focused leader with deep brand and launch experience in the psychiatric and/or neuroscience space (CNS).

Key Responsibilities

  • Launch & Brand Strategy Development: Lead commercial launch strategy, ensuring successful brand positioning, HCP engagement, and market activation. Ensure alignment of all cross-functional plans to overall brand strategy
  • HCP Marketing Leadership: Develop and oversee HCP engagement strategies, including non-personal promotion (NPP), speaker programs, congresses, and KOL partnerships.
  • Consumer Marketing: Drive consumer engagement initiatives, ensuring effective education and activation efforts that align with market needs and patient journeys.
  • Omnichannel & Digital Strategy: Lead omnichannel marketing efforts and personalized engagement content, integrating digital, personal, and non-personal promotional approaches to maximize reach and engagement.
  • Market Insights & Competitive Analysis: Utilize market research, analytics, and competitive intelligence to refine marketing strategies and anticipate market shifts.
  • Sales Enablement: Develop messaging, promotional materials, segmentation, and field guidance to support the salesforce in driving HCP engagement and adoption. Guide development of training and meetings to align with brand strategy.
  • Market Access: Partner with market access teams to ensure payer engagement, reimbursement strategy alignment, channel strategy, development of affordability and access programs, patient support solutions, and pull-through execution.
  • Cross-Functional Leadership: Collaborate closely with medical, regulatory, commercial operations, and finance teams to ensure cohesive brand execution.
  • Performance Measurement & Optimization: Define and track key performance indicators (KPIs) to assess brand performance and optimize investments
  • Financial Management: Oversee development of net sales and demand forecasts along with overall launch P&L to optimize profitability
  • Budget & Resource Management: Oversee marketing budgets and resource allocation, ensuring efficiency and ROI optimization.
  • Team Leadership & Development: Lead a team of HCP and consumer franchise brand marketers, providing guidance, mentorship, and strategic direction to drive high performance and execution excellence.
